Social media has become an integral part of our daily lives, influencing various aspects of communication, information sharing, and networking. With the rise of social media platforms such as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, LinkedIn, and YouTube, entrepreneurs have recognized the potential of these platforms as powerful tools for business promotion and marketing. Kirtis & Karahan (2011). Michael E. Porter in his research paper Strategy and the Internet, 2001, says that emerging digital media technologies, particularly the Internet, social networking sites have changed the market and business dynamics by creating a shift in the firms’ competitive positions and increasing consumer power (Arora & Sanni, 2018).
Entrepreneurs are increasingly leveraging social media to connect with their target audience, build brand awareness, and promote their products or services. Unlike traditional marketing methods, social media allows entrepreneurs to interact directly with their customers, engage in real-time conversations, and receive immediate feedback. It also offers cost effective options for advertising and enables entrepreneurs to reach a wider audience beyond geographical boundaries. Arora & Sanni (2018)
Many successful entrepreneurs have utilized social media platforms to gain a competitive edge in the market. (Mukolwe & Korir, 2016) They have used various strategies such as creating engaging content, running targeted ad campaigns, collaborating with influencers, and leveraging user-generated content to enhance their brand visibility and customer engagement.
However, despite the increasing popularity of social media as a business promotion tool, there is still a need for research to understand its effectiveness and identify the most effective strategies and techniques for entrepreneurs. This study aims to bridge this gap by examining the use of social media as a tool for business promotion by entrepreneurs and exploring the factors that contribute to its success. By investigating the relationship between social media usage and business promotion, this study seeks to provide valuable insights for entrepreneurs looking to harness the power of social media for their businesses.
1.2 Problem Statement
The use of appropriate social media marketing strategies accounts for the growth of small business and companies, increase traffic on products as well as profits, the use of social media platforms in the marketing of business products stands to be one of the most easiest, cost-effective approaches to business promotion and growth, however, businesses both small and big soon crumble due to poor marketing skills and social media visibility, also, the use of modern technology is a factor mostly appreciated by the youthful population while the older population of local business owners brush off the use of sophisticated platforms for business promotion owing to the old mentality and trust of physically present customers which is not the case in social media marketing.
Furthermore, although social media marketing is a well-researched topic, it has only been studied through experimental and theoretical research; studies never precisely describe the benefits retailers gain from this marketing tactic. In reviewing the rich plethora of multi-disciplinary literature, it is has become clear that studies are focusing on describing what social media marketing is as well as examining what factors affect consumer behavior relative to social networking. Despite the initial progress made by researchers, development in this area of study has been limited. Thus, the aim of this study which is to investigate the practical use of social media platforms as tools for business promotion by entrepreneurs.
